The Senior Accountant reports to the Director of Close & Consolidation and is responsible for a variety of complex monthend closing activities journal entry preparation account analysis intercompany transactions account reconciliations and monthend consolidations. This role collaborates closely with finance and business unit teams across the organization to ensure seamless financial operations.
Key Responsibilities:
- Prepare journal entries in the core ERP system and supporting platforms.
- Identify and resolve intercompany discrepancies in collaboration with crossfunctional teams.
- Prepare and analyze the monthend consolidated intercompany matching schedule.
- Assist in preparing consolidated financial statements in accordance with US GAAP on a monthly quarterly and annual basis ensuring accuracy and timely reporting.
- Maintain foreign exchange rates in accounting systems to support proper consolidation and valuation.
- Assist in managing the chart of accounts to align with finance and external reporting requirements.
- Support the quarterly and annual external reporting process and prepare consolidated supporting schedules.
- Ensure compliance with SOX controls related to consolidation.
- Administer the Blackline reconciliation system.
- Coordinate with internal and external auditors.
- Assist with financial reporting tieouts UAT (User Acceptance Testing) and other special projects as required.
- Support internal management reporting and statutory reporting requests.
- Identify opportunities for process improvements and lead efforts to implement process change
Qualifications :
- Bachelors degree in accounting.
- Minimum of five years of accounting experience; public accounting experience is a plus.
- Strong understanding of intercompany foreign currency translation and topside journal entries.
- Proficiency in US GAAP accounting policies and processes.
- Experience working with multiple legal entities and subsidiaries within a parent company structure.
- Experience with SAP S/4HANA SAP Group Reporting and Blackline is a plus.
- Advanced Excel skills including Pivot Tables and VLOOKUP.
- Strong analytical problemsolving and organizational skills with keen attention to detail.
- Ability to multitask in a fastpaced environment and collaborate effectively across teams and organizational levels.
